
Lipton spills the tea on peachy April Fool's prank
share on
Beverage company Lipton has caused an uproar with an early April Fool's Day prank. In an Instagram post last Tuesday (18 March), Lipton shared the devasating news that it would be discontinuing its iconic peach-flavoured ice tea.
The "Rest in peach" post acknowledged the hurt it had caused and assured fans that the loved flavour may make a legendary comeback in the future. "We appreciated your understanding during this period of adjustment and apologise for any inconvenience caused," it added.
Fans around the world were devastated by the news, with several TikTok users sharing their despair through hilarious clips.

"My day has been ruined," one TikTok user wrote, posting a video of themselves falling to their knees.
Others posted about how they were "hoarding" the beloved flavour before it ran out.
A day later, the beverage giant revealed that its previous announcement was an early April Fool's joke, assuring fans that the peach ice tea was here to stay.
"I'd never take away your favourite flavour, pookies," the post read. Lipton also revealed that it will be sending a surprise to the biggest fans with the best reactions of the tea's discontinuation.
While fans were relieved to hear that their favoruite tea flavour was here to stay, some were "affected" by Lipton's prank.
"I saw my life flash before my eyes," one TikTok user wrote.

Lipton isn't the only brand in recent times to have stirred the online pot with a seemingly harmless stunt. In February this year, Duolingo unveiled that its mascot, Duo, had passed on. In an Instagram post, the online language learning app shared the puzzling news with the public.
"Authorities are currently investigating his cause of death and we are cooperating fully," the statement read, with Duolingo cheekily insinuating that their mascot most likely died while waiting for users to complete their lessons. Many Duolingo users mourned the loss of the iconic mascot, with some rushing to complete their language lessons on the app.
